If zeina has seven times as many books as ali if zeina gave ali 15 books they would eash have the same number of books how many
kramer

Answer:

<em>Zeina had 35 books and Ali had 5 books</em>

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Equations</u>

We know Zeina has seven times as many books as Ali. If we call

x = Number of books Ali has

Then Zeina has

7x = Number of books Zeina has

We also know if Zeina gave Ali 15 books, they would have the same number of books, thus:

x + 15 = 7x - 15

Adding 15:

x + 15 +15 = 7x

Subtracting x:

15 +15 = 7x - x

Operating:

30 = 6x

Dividing by 6:

x = 30 / 6

x =5

7x = 35

Thus Zeina had 35 books and Ali had 5 books
